Manage Expectations Realistically
Misaligned expectations are one of the biggest sources of conflict. Parents may expect rapid results. Teenagers may expect minimal effort. The reality lies somewhere in between.
We guide families by:
- Providing realistic treatment timelines
- Explaining potential challenges
- Reinforcing the importance of compliance
- Tracking progress transparently
Celebrating small wins along the way can shift the experience from pressure to progress.
The Role of Compliance in Successful Treatment
Orthodontic success depends heavily on consistency.
For example:
- Wearing aligners 20–22 hours daily
- Attending appointments
- Maintaining oral hygiene
- Following dietary advice (for braces)
When teenagers understand that their effort directly impacts their results, cooperation improves significantly.

Creating a Positive Orthodontic Experience at Home
A supportive home environment makes a significant difference.
Parents can help by:
- Encouraging rather than enforcing
- Recognising effort, not just results
- Avoiding unnecessary pressure
- Keeping communication calm and constructive
Orthodontic treatment is a journey, not a race.
